Research suggests that a significant variety of adults with ADHD remain undiagnosed, and the symptoms can persist into the adult years, affecting numerous aspects of life, including work, relationships, and self-confidence. Thankfully, numerous free online ADHD tests are offered that can help adults evaluate their symptoms and decide whether they ought to seek expert help.What is ADHD?ADHD is a neurodevelopmental disorder characterized by patterns of neg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siveness. While it is frequently identified in children, lots of adults battle with the exact same issues without ever getting an official diagnosis. Symptoms can differ commonly and might consist of:Difficulty concentrating or completing jobsForgetfulness and lack of organizationImpulsive decision-makingUneasyness and difficulty sitting stillProblem managing time and meeting deadlinesWhy Are Free ADHD Tests Important?Selecting to take a free ADHD test can be the first action in acknowledging symptoms and comprehending how they might be impacting an individual’s life. These tests are not an alternative to a formal diagnosis from a health care professional, but they can provide valuable insights and guide individuals regarding whether they must seek further assessment.Key Features of Free ADHD TestsBefore taking an ADHD test, it’s useful to comprehend what to expect. When to Seek Professional HelpIf a specific ratings high up on an ADHD test or has consistent symptoms impacting their every day life, it may be time to speak with a professional. ADHD examinations generally involve:A comprehensive scientific interviewBehavioral assessmentsFeedback from household or considerable othersRegularly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: Are free ADHD tests accurate?A1: Free ADHD tests can offer a preliminary indicator of whether you might have ADHD symptoms. Nevertheless, they are not replacements for a formal diagnosis from a certified doctor.Q2: How do I understand if I should take an ADHD test?A2: If you often discover yourself having problem with attention, organization, uneasyness, or impulsiveness, it might be helpful to take an ADHD test to examine your symptoms.Q3: What should I do after taking a test?A3: Review your outcomes thoroughly and consider looking for further evaluation with a professional if you score extremely or associate with numerous symptoms talked about.Q4: Can ADHD symptoms worsen with age?A4: Yes, many adults report that ADHD symptoms can change or intensify with age, particularly if they are not correctly managed.Q5: What treatments are offered for adult ADHD?A5: Treatment choices include medication, c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), lifestyle modifications, and support groups. A mental health expert can help determine the very best technique for each person.Utilizing free ADHD tests provides adults with an important avenue to assess their symptoms and comprehend their mental health better. Whether the results suggest a low probability of ADHD or recommend further assessment is required, these tests can be a vital primary step toward better self-awareness and mental well-being. Always keep in mind that while these tests can be useful, a conclusive diagnosis must come from a certified healthcare professional.
